As someone's dragged it up... for reference, it was a MAF fault. Replaced it and the revs were permanently high. Paid Jaguar 1/2 hour workshop time to plug it in, they altered some stuff relating to the MAF and it was perfect afterwards. Simply changing the MAF was not enough to fix the fault.

Hope this update might help someone else in the same boat
